Agouti (Dasyprocta spp.)

node · earth · Neotropical forest, including the Amazon Basin

A diurnal caviomorph rodent of the neotropical forest floor, the size of a small dog, and the single link on which Brazil nut regeneration hangs. It is one of the very few animals capable of gnawing through the woody capsule that encloses the seeds, and it does not simply eat them: it scatter-hoards, burying seeds singly at distance from the parent tree and retrieving most but not all of them. The seeds it forgets are the next generation of trees. The dependency runs in one direction and is therefore fragile in an asymmetric way - agoutis eat many things and would persist without Brazil nuts, while the tree has no alternative disperser at the scale it needs. Hunting pressure on agoutis and other large-bodied forest rodents thus registers in the Brazil nut population decades later, which is the kind of lag that makes ecological damage hard to attribute.
